About the role
As a Marketplace Business Analyst, you will own the data and analytics foundation that supports InfoTrack Exchange’s supply-side marketplace. You will connect operational data from ServeManager and Snowflake with strategic decision-making related to geographic expansion, partner agency recruitment, coverage reporting, and goal tracking. Combining strong business analysis with hands-on analytics engineering, you will turn complex data into actionable insights and build reliable reporting solutions that make information accessible, accurate, and trusted across the organization.
This is a remote role that may be performed from an approved location within the United States.
Compensation
This role offers a competitive compensation range of $95,000 to $160,000 depending on experience, skills, and internal equity.

What You'll Do:
- Build and maintain reporting for InfoTrack Exchange’s supply-side marketplace, including county-level coverage, agency performance, service-level agreement compliance, and business intelligence dashboards.
- Own and maintain the partner agency data model, replacing manual spreadsheets with an integrated view of agency status, volume, tier, coverage area, and pipeline stage.
- Partner with Operations to standardize agency sourcing and qualification processes and create pipeline visibility that supports proactive recruitment in new markets.
- Develop financial and operational models to guide geographic expansion decisions, including market sizing, coverage gap analysis, and agency capacity modeling for current and future markets.
- Collaborate with Engineering and Business Intelligence teams to transform ad hoc Snowflake queries into reliable, governed reports and contribute to data model documentation and schema design.
- Define, track, and report on key performance indicators and product initiative success metrics, presenting coverage and performance insights to leadership.
